NoSuchElementException错误表示尝试使用Scanner类从输入流中读取元素时,输入流中没有更多的元素可供读取。因此,我们可以在代码中添加tr...
这可能是由于Atmel Studio默认使用-Funroll-loops参数而导致的。您可以通过将其值更改为-fno-unroll-loops来禁用此选项来优化...
在发送AT命令后,需要不断读取串口接收缓冲区中的数据,并在读取到'call ready”响应后停止读取。同时,为了避免AT命令执行失败,需要适当增加延时等待,确...
在C#中使用AT命令传输消息的解决方法是通过串口通信来发送AT命令并接收响应。以下是一个使用C#通过串口通信发送AT命令的示例代码:using System;u...
以下是ATM机的C程序示例:#include #include int main(){float balance = 1000;int option;float...
在Atmel Cortex M4 SAM4S处理器的PMC界面中,启动时间变量的目的是控制外设启动的时间。在该处理器中,控制和调节启动时间变量的寄存器是PMC_...
Atmel Studio是一个常用的集成开发环境,用于Atmel公司的微控制器程序开发。Atmel Studio仿真指的是在该环境中使用仿真器来模拟运行程序,便...
可能原因:机器故障钞票堆积在机器里银行账户余额不足或ATM机限制了最大取款金额解决方案:首先检查机器是否出现故障,并联系维修人员修理。如果钞票堆积在机器里,可以...
要在Atmel Studio中返回包含数组的寄存器,您可以按照以下步骤进行操作:在Atmel Studio中创建一个新的项目或打开一个现有的项目。在项目文件夹中...
在AT命令中实现“Ctrl + Z”动作,需要将字符“^Z”插入到AT命令的结尾位置。具体实现方法如下:C++代码示例:string atCmd = "AT+C...
在Atmel Studio中生成位置无关代码时产生不需要的代码,可以尝试以下解决方法:确保已使用正确的编译选项生成位置无关代码。在项目属性中,将“语言”选项设置...
一种可能的解决方法是使用下面的代码,以通过在ATmega32U4上的USB端口进行转发来实现USB连接:#include #include SoftwareSe...
对齐错误是指在使用ATMEL汇编器时,数据或指令的对齐方式与要求的对齐方式不一致。在汇编语言中,数据和指令通常需要按照特定的对齐方式放置在内存中,以便处理器能够...
在使用AT命令进行通信时,有时候可能会遇到文本模式选择不起作用的问题。下面是一种可能的解决方法:import serial# 初始化串口连接ser = seri...
NoSuchElementException 错误指出了代码中的某个点在尝试访问队列中的元素时,该队列为空。对于 ATM 机器应用程序,可能存在以下情况:当用户...
这个问题是由于ATmel处理器的ELF文件格式不支持全局构造函数。为了避免这个问题,可以使用AVR-GCC作为编译器,而不是LLVM。或者,也可以使用特殊的标记...
要修复AT命令ESP8266 01中的响应链接类型错误或无法连接TCP的问题,您可以按照以下步骤进行操作:确保您已正确设置了ESP8266模块的串口通信参数,包...
Atmosphere是一个Web框架,它允许开发者快速开发具有实时通信和推送功能的Web应用程序。Tomcat是一个流行的Java Web服务器。Descrip...
确认Atmel Studio已正确安装并升级至最新版本;尝试制作一个新的空白解决方案,然后打开调试模式工具窗口(Debug - Windows - Output...
可以使用转义字符来避免这个问题。将双引号“替换为转义字符“\”即可。以下是一个示例代码:# 发送命令AT+SOME_COMMAND="param1","para...